To be fair I micrometer may not be that much use, and if its on anything plastic, it wont work at all anyway. When I got into a dispute over my XF paintwork, I tested it with a paint guage and it was all over the place. Varied from 100 microns in places to over 250 in others. On the same panel you could get variances of 100 microns. Some of the most uneven thickness of paintwork Ive ever heard of.
